Still, little-known to the outside world despite its huge success, Sunra is China's leading maker of electric vehicles (EVs) with an annual production capacity of more than four million EVs of various makes. It's also been the world's top-selling EV brand for the past five years.

Now, this company has set its sights on India, which it sees as the world's biggest market for electric bikes (e-bikes) within the next decade. It plans to set up a factory in India to not only build the popular e-bikes (or bikes with small electric motors) but its other EVs such as Electric Scooters; Electric Motorcycles; Electric Tricycles and Electric Cars. Sunra exports its e-bikes and spares to some 70 countries.

Based in Wuxi in Jiangsu Province and with production plants in five other Chinese provinces, Sunra says it's upbeat about investing in India. It's delighted about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i's encouraging policies for the EV sector and his invitation that companies like Sunra manufacture their EVs in India.

Sunra is studying India's policies and wants to build a factory in India, most likely in Bangalore (Bengaluru), said Sunra General Manager Victor Lu. Lu is confident India will outpace China in four or five years in terms of demand for e-vehicles.

He said his company sees India as the world's biggest market for e-bikes "and we want to tap into it." He said the high levels of pollution in Delhi and other Indian cities means people will want to switch to e-bikes very soon. In addition, the Modi government's decision to encourage the use of e-vehicles "is all the more reason for us to invest in India."

India is the world's second-largest greenhouse gas emitter after China and has many of the world's most polluted cities. India's extensive pollution is one of the reasons the Modi government wants India to switch to e-vehicles. New Delhi estimates switching to e-vehicles will also significantly slash India's oil bill and reduce motor vehicle emissions by 37 percent.

According to the World Health Organization (WHO), the top 10 most polluted cities in the world based on the pervasiveness of microscopic PM2.5 (particulate matter with a size of 2.5 microns) in the atmosphere are (from most polluted to least polluted): Kanpur, Faridabad, Varanasi, Gaya, Patna, Delhi, Lucknow, Agra and Muzaffarpur.

All these cities are in India. The only non-Indian city on the list is Bamenda in Cameroon, which is number eight.

Lu said Sunra already has a presence in India with its exports of batteries, spares parts and e-bikes. Sunra's Indian operations are small-time, said Lu, and so are its partners. "Now, we want to go big," he said.

On the bright side, Sunra already has two Sunra bike models on Indian roads. Lu said a further six models are currently being tested by the "Automotive Research Association of India."

Lu said Sunra currently makes only 20 percent of its bikes for the Indian market, "but we want it to be 80 percent in the future."

In 2017, 777,000 EVs were sold in China compared to 507,000 in 2016. This makes China the leader in both the supply and demand for EVs.
